本文导读目录:
3、lastindexof(lastIndexOf查找数组字符串和indexof效果一样了)
win怎么使用自动修复软件(win怎么自动修复系统)
本文为大家介绍win怎么使用自动修复软件(win怎么自动修复系统),下面和小编一起看看详细内容吧。win自动修复功能是在系统出现死机死机黑屏蓝屏等情况后,可以帮助用户修复和维护系统的功能,但是很多用户不知道如何使用这个功能,下面我们就来看看详细教程win自动修复使用方法:第一:win系统出现问题后,可以直接使用“自动修复”来修复win系统,也就是winRE功能步步高学习电脑(诺基亚2700c刷机)。
二:winRE的种启动方式。
诺基亚2700c刷机希尔排序怎么排啊?选择排序的基本选择排序
三趟结果Shell排序的算法实现:.不设监视哨的算法描述voidShellPass(SeqListR,.稳定性选择排序是给每个位置选择当前元素最小的,该趟排序从当前无序区中选出关键字最小的记录R[k],②第趟排序在无序区R[..n]中选出关键字最小的记录R[k],希尔排序怎么排啊下标???????????????????数组???????????(原数组)增量=,?=与=为一组,互换为???(排序是从小到大)????????=与=为一组,互换为???????????=与=为一组,互换为??????????=与=为一组,互换为??????????=与=?为一组,互换为??增量=的排序结果是:??????????下标????????????????????数组?????????????(第一趟之后)增量=,?=,=,=,=,=为一组,????????互换之后,=,=,=,=,=????????=,=,=,=,=为一组,????????互换之后,=,=,=,=,=增量=的排序结果是:??????????下标????????????????????数组?????????????(第二趟之后)增量=,?数组里的个数据作为一组,其中,????????=有=互换为??????????=与=互换为??增量=的排序结果是:??????????//?C语言测试代码//?希尔排序法?(自定增量)#include?《stdio.h》#include?《stdlib.h》void?printData(int?data,int?n)?//打印数组{????int?i;????for(i=;i《n;i++)????{????????printf(“%d?“,data[i]);????}????printf(“
“);}//希尔排序(从小到大)void?shell(int?data,int?count){????int?offset_a={,,};?//每一趟的增量??步步高学习电脑(诺基亚2700c刷机)??int?len;????int?pos;????int?offset;????int?i,j;????int?temp;????len=sizeof(offset_a)/sizeof(int);????for(i=;i《len;i++)????{????????offset=offset_a[i];????????for(j=offset;j《count;j++)????????{????????????temp=data[j];????????????pos=j-offset;????????????while(temp《data[pos]?&&?pos》=?&&?j《=count)????????????{????????????????data[pos+offset]=data[pos];????????????????pos=pos-offset;????????????}????????????data[pos+offset]=temp;????????}????????printf(“增量=%d,排序结果:?“,offset);????????printData(data,count);????}}int?main(void){????int?data={,,,,,,,,,};????int?count;????count=sizeof(data)/sizeof(int);????printf(“原数组:?“);????printData(data,count);????shell(data,count);????printf(“
最后的排序结果:?“);????printData(data,count);????return?;}选择排序的基本选择排序排序算法即解决以下问题的算法:原序列的一个重排《a*,a*,a*,...,an*》,让他跟数组中第二个元素交换一下值,即所有记录放在同一组中进行直接插入排序为止,我们知道第一遍选择第个元素会和交换。
诺基亚2700c刷机lastindexof(lastIndexOf查找数组字符串和indexof效果一样了
lastIndexOf查找数组字符串和indexof效果一样了
searchValue一个字符串,表示被查找的值。.fromIndex从调用该方法字符串的此位置处开始查找。可以是任意整数。默认值为str.length。如果为负值,则被看作。如果fromIndex》str.length,则fromIndex被看作str.length。区分大小写lastIndexOf方法区分大小写步步高学习电脑(诺基亚2700c刷机)。例如,下面的表达式返回-:?“BlueWhale,KillerWhale“.lastIndexOf(“blue“);//returns-lastIndexOf的用法?//Createanarray.varar=[“ab“,“cd“,“ef“,“ab“,“cd“];//找到最后一个CD的位置document.write(ar.lastIndexOf(“cd“)+“《br/》“);//输出://从正数第二个位置,搜索倒数第一个CD的位置document.write(ar.lastIndexOf(“cd“,)+“《br/》“);//输出://从倒数第三个搜索最后一个ab的位置document.write(ar.lastIndexOf(“ab“,-)+“《br/》“);//输出:同样String.lastIndexOf的用法类似?“canal“.lastIndexOf(“a“)//returns“canal“.lastIndexOf(“a“,)//returns“canal“.lastIndexOf(“a“,)//returns-从第个往前搜,不存在’a’,返回-“canal“.lastIndexOf(“x“)//returns-lastIndexOf的IE实现不过微软的IE及其以下并不支持Array.lastIndexOf,需要兼容实现。可以参考:?if(!Array.prototype.lastIndexOf){Array.prototype.lastIndexOf=function(searchElement/*,fromIndex*/){’usestrict’;if(this===void||this===null){thrownewTypeError();}varn,k,t=Object(this),len=t.length》》》;if(len===){return-;}n=len-;if(arguments.length》){n=Number(arguments);if(n!=n){n=;}elseif(n!=&&n!=(/)&&n!=-(/)){n=(n》||-)*Math.floor(Math.abs(n));}}for(k=n》=?Math.min(n,len-):len-Math.abs(n);k》=;k--){if(kint&&t[k]===searchElement){returnk;}}return-;};}可以使用ES-Slim使旧版浏览器完全兼容ES语法。
JavaScript中的lastIndexOf(怎么用
返回String对象中子字符串最后出现的位置。strObj.lastIndexOf(substring[,startindex])参数strObj必选项。String对象或文字。substring必选项。要在String对象内查找的子字符串。startindex可选项。该整数值指出在String对象内进行查找的开始索引位置。如果省略,则查找从字符串的末尾开始。说明lastIndexOf方法返回一个整数值,指出String对象内子字符串的开始位置。如果没有找到子字符串,则返回-。如果startindex是负数,则startindex被当作零。如果它比最大字符位置索引还大,则它被当作最大的可能索引。从右向左执行查找。否则,该方法和indexOf相同。下面的示例说明了lastIndexOf方法的用法:functionlastIndexDemo(str){varstr=“BABEBIBOBUBABEBIBOBU“vars=str.lastIndexOf(str);return(s);}
步步高学习电脑的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于诺基亚2700c刷机、步步高学习电脑的信息别忘了在本站进行查找喔。